Here you find various information on the brightest lines, ordered in wavelength:
Wavelengths (Angstroms); weighted oscillator strengths (gf);
transition probabilities (A);
intensities (normalised) at
106 , 1010, 1015, 1020
cm-3;
together with:
Configuration; Term; Index of the level (1=ground); Energy (observed if available - otherwise theoretical);
of the lower (l) and upper levels (u)
Note that intensities have been calculated at log T[K]=5.20, where the ion fraction peaks in ionization equilibrium. Only lines brighter than 0.001 the strongest line (at all densities) are retained.
